St. Olaf hosts Quadrangular meet

1/27/2018 10:40:00 AM

Results

NORTHFIELD, Minn. - The St. Olaf women's track and field team hosted a meet in Tostrud Center on Friday night with Bethel, Gustavus, and St. Thomas in attendance.

Mackenzie Schoustra won the 60 meter hurdles after qualifying with a season best of 9.41.  She won again in the finals in 9.51.  Lori Erlandson just missed qualifying for finals by one place.  Lillie Meakim took top honors in the 60 meter dash, running 8.35 and 8.25 in prelims and finals respectively.

Lauren Markowski and Holly Gordon were first and second in the 5000 meter race, running times of 19:25.16 and 19:30.14.  Also in the distance events, Katie Spray finished fourth in the mile (5:29.31), and Byony Hawgood and Mary Naas were second (10:45.54) and fourth (10:49.53) in the 3000 meters.

In the field events, Katherine LeClaire was fourth in the weight throw with a toss of 10.75 meters, and third in the shot put with a 9.04 meter throw.  Jessica Bentley won the shot with a winning throw of 11.90 meters.

Haily Marquette and Emily Bohlig finished first and second in the long jump with flights of 4.79 and 4.73 meters respectively.  Bohlig was third in the high jump as well, clearing 1.48 meters.

St. Olaf collected 151 points, only finishing five behind the winners from St. Thomas with 156,

The Oles will compete next at the Carleton Meet of Hearts next Saturday.
